Don Jazzy, the music producer, has revealed that he didn’t release his song with Wizkid, the Afrobeats singer, because it wasn’t good enough.

Don Jazzy spoke recently in a question & answer session on his Instagram page.

A follower had asked the producer when he would collaborate with the Grammy-winning singer.

“When will you have a song with Wizkid? What has been delaying the Grammy award song?” the follower asked.

In his response, Don Jazzy said they worked on two songs together that were unreleased because they weren’t up to standard.

The Mavin Records head honcho said he and Wizkid may drop more collaborative songs in the future.

“We actually did like two songs a while back but we never released it. I don’t know, I think it wasn’t good enough,” he said.

“Sometimes we have those days when you do some songs and people are not feeling it like that.

“But then we had ‘Surulere’ remix. I think that’s the only time that we have worked other than those other two songs that I said we did but didn’t put out.
